VSAT

VSAT is a short form for Very Small Aperture Terminals. There are three main components of the VSAT Technology – The Satellite, A Central Hub (With a Big Dish Antenna) and a number of smaller dish antennas kept at various remote locations that together form a Star topology using the satellite network. Therefore, basically, all the antennas communicate with the central hub through the satellite as the medium for such communications.

Remote access is the greatest strength of VSAT Networks. A satellite can provide connectivity to any remote location like ships at sea, remote coastal regions, mountains, and areas with no terrestrial connectivity.

Satcom

 

Satellites Communications offer a number of features not radially available with other terrestrial means of communications. Because very large areas of the earth are visible from a satellite orbiting in Geostationary Earth Orbit (GEO) or non- GEO, the satellite can form the hub of a hub and spoke communication network – similar to terrestrial PtMP – with the added feature of providing effective communications to sparsely populated areas around the globe with tough geographical terrain which are difficult to access with traditional terrestrial technologies…..   Provide an effective platform to relay radio signals between points on the ground, at sea, and in the air.

In recent years, satellite systems are competing directly in some markets with the more established broadcasting media, including over-the-air TV and cable TV, and with high-speed Internet access services like digital subscriber line (DSL) and cable modems as well as two way mobile voice communications and backhaul networks.
